Experimental studies of the application of the Er:YAG laser on dental hard substances: I. Measurement of the ablation rate

Abstract

Up to now lasers have not achieved any practical importance in dentistry for drilling teeth because of considerable damage to the surrounding tissue. We studied the application of pulsed 2.94 microns Er:YAG laser radiation in vitro on extracted teeth to remove enamel, dentin, and carious lesions. The depth and diameter of laser-drilled holes were measured as a function of pulse number and radiant exposure. The tissue removal is very effective both for dentin and enamel.
